Hello all and TY in advance. I have two forms that add to the same MySql table. In my model I have tried to parse the data depending on which form they came from. When I try it I get a:
A Database Error Occurred
You must use the "set" method to update an entry.
I'm trying to insert new data, not alter existing data.
Code:
<?php
class Patients extends Model {
function Patients(){
parent::Model();
}
function add_schedule($ptID){
$da =array();
if ($this->input->post('sche_CDate') == TRUE){
$da = array(
'demo_NumID' => $ptID,
'sche_date' =>$this->input->post('sche_CDate'),
'sche_type' => 'con',
'sche_location' => 'jcc');
}
if ($this->input->post('sche_RDate') == TRUE){
$da = array(
'demo_NumID' => $ptID,
'sche_date' =>$this->input->post('sche_RDate'),
'sche_type' => 'ref',
'sche_location' => 'jcc');
}
if ($this->input->post('fromform') == 'yes'){
$da = array(
'demo_NumID' => $ptID,
'sche_date' => $this->input->post('sche_date'),
'sche_type' => $this->input->post('sche_type'),
'sche_location' => $this->input->post('sche_location'));
}
$this->db->insert('schedule', $da);
}
}
